Understanding the market rates for video editing services can help you budget your project effectively. According to OnlineJobs.ph’s comprehensive salary guide, rates for skilled Adobe Premiere Pro video editors range from $6 to $15 per hour.
Here’s a breakdown to give you insights into what you can expect:
Experience Level | Hourly Rate (USD) | Project Rate (USD) |
Entry-level (0-2 years) | $6 - $10 | $50 - $200 |
Mid-level (2-5 years) | $10 - $15 | $200 - $500 |
Senior level (5+ years) | $15 - $25 | $500 - $1,500+ |

Once you have hired your editor, the journey doesn’t end there. Here are a few tips on how to manage your remote video editor effectively:
Just as important as hiring the right candidate is setting clear expectations from the get-go. Outline deliverables, deadlines, and payment terms upfront. Use project management tools like Trello or Asana to track progress.
Regular check-ins can go a long way. Schedule weekly or bi-weekly video calls to discuss project statuses, give feedback, and provide direction. This will help build trust and ensure everyone is on the same page.
Encourage your editor to share ideas or suggest improvements. A collaborative environment helps in crafting better videos and shows that you value their creative input.
As you embark on this hiring journey, be aware of common pitfalls:
Different cultures can have various interpretations of feedback, deadlines, and professionalism. Be explicit in your communication.
The Philippines is in a different time zone. Being mindful of this will help in planning meetings and establishing deadlines.
Hiring based solely on rates can lead to disappointment. Always prioritize quality over cost.
